From a UI point-pf-view, it makes since to have the "Home" button separated from
the other user-definable buttons.  "Home" is a special button that doesn't
operate like the rest - when the user drags a URL to the home button, they
receive a dialog asking whether they want that URL to become their home page.  

This special behavior has to be somehow identified by some sort of special
positioning.  Currently, that's by placing the "Home" button on its own, left of
the Bookmarks button.  If the Home button is moved, make sure that something
identifies that it's "not just another link"
